Cargando…

Formal Methods for Safety and Security : Case Studies for Aerospace Applications.

Annotation

Detalles Bibliográficos
Clasificación:Libro Electrónico
Autor principal: Nanda, Manju
Otros Autores: Jeppu, Yogananda
Formato: Electrónico eBook
Idioma:Inglés
Publicado: Singapore : Springer Singapore, 2017.
Temas:
Acceso en línea:Texto completo

MARC

LEADER 00000cam a2200000Mi 4500
001 EBOOKCENTRAL_on1012347666
003 OCoLC
005 20240329122006.0
006 m o d
007 cr |n|---|||||
008 171118s2017 si o 000 0 eng d
040 |a EBLCP  |b eng  |e pn  |c EBLCP  |d OCLCQ  |d WYU  |d UKAHL  |d OCLCQ  |d REDDC  |d OCLCF  |d OCLCO  |d OCLCL 
020 |a 9789811041211 
020 |a 9811041210 
035 |a (OCoLC)1012347666 
050 4 |a TA1-2040 
082 0 4 |a 005.1 
049 |a UAMI 
100 1 |a Nanda, Manju. 
245 1 0 |a Formal Methods for Safety and Security :  |b Case Studies for Aerospace Applications. 
260 |a Singapore :  |b Springer Singapore,  |c 2017. 
300 |a 1 online resource (138 pages) 
336 |a text  |b txt  |2 rdacontent 
337 |a computer  |b c  |2 rdamedia 
338 |a online resource  |b cr  |2 rdacarrier 
588 0 |a Print version record. 
505 0 |a Preface -- Acknowledgements -- Contents -- About the Editors -- 1 Formal Methodsâ#x80;#x94;A Need for Practical Applications -- Abstract -- 1.1 Introduction -- 1.2 Error and Failures in Software Systems -- 1.3 A Paradigm Shift in Systems Engineering -- 1.4 Return on Investment -- 1.5 A Need for Case Studies -- 1.6 Paper Summary -- 1.7 Final Words -- References -- 2 Formal Methods and Tools for Safety of Critical Systems -- Abstract -- 2.1 Introduction -- 2.2 Literature Survey -- 2.2.1 Formal Methods-Based Databaseâ#x80;#x94;Intelligent Knowledge Database (IKD) 
505 8 |a 2.2.2 Development of Tool Related and Tool Applicability Metrics2.2.3 Development of Process Related Metrics -- 2.3 Approach -- 2.3.1 RTCA DO-178B/178C Software Development Life-Cycle -- 2.4 Conclusion and Future Scope -- Acknowledgements -- References -- 3 Taming the Enemy: Framework for Comparative Analysis of Safe String Libraries -- Abstract -- 3.1 Introduction -- 3.1.1 How Are Strings Represented in C? -- 3.1.2 Common String Issues in C -- 3.1.3 Why Are Strings in C the Way They Are? -- 3.2 Safe String Libraries -- 3.3 Related Work 
505 8 |a 3.4 Purpose of Work3.5 Selection of Libraries -- 3.6 Selection of Parameters of Interest -- 3.7 Creation of Test Suites -- 3.8 Devising Metrics for Safe String Libraries -- 3.8.1 Metric for Functional Coverage -- 3.8.2 Metric for Bounds Protection -- 3.8.3 Performance Percentile -- 3.9 Results -- 3.9.1 Static Safe String Libraries -- 3.9.2 Dynamic Safe String Libraries -- 3.10 Conclusion -- References -- 4 Dynamic Constrained Objects for Vehicular Network Modeling -- Abstract -- 4.1 Introduction -- 4.2 Related Work 
505 8 |a 4.3 COB: A Constrained Object Language4.4 Dynamic COB with Metric Temporal Operators -- 4.5 Vehicular Network Modeling -- 4.6 Conclusion and Future Work -- References -- 5 Adoption of Formal Methods in Software Safety Analysis -- Abstract -- 5.1 Introduction -- 5.2 Work -- 5.3 Conclusion -- 6 Model-Based Safety Validation for Embedded Real-Time Systems -- Abstract -- 6.1 Introduction -- 6.2 Modeling a Safety Critical System in AADL -- 6.2.1 Error Modeling Using Annex EMV2 -- 6.2.2 Behavior Modeling Using Behavior Annex BLESS 
505 8 |a 6.2.3 Basic System Modeling Using AADL6.3 Automatic Flight Control System: Case Study -- 6.3.1 Overview of AFCS -- 6.3.2 Error Modeling of AFCS -- 6.3.3 Behavior Modeling of AFCS -- 6.4 Safety Validation of an Embedded System -- 6.5 Derivation of Safety Parameters from AADL Models -- 6.6 Safety Validation of Flight Control System -- 6.7 Conclusion -- References -- 7 Arguing Formally About Flight Control Laws Using SLDV and NuSMV -- Abstract -- 7.1 Introduction -- 7.2 Simulink Design Verifier -- 7.3 NuSMV -- 7.4 Autopilot Mode Transition 
500 |a ""7.5 Automated Validation"" 
520 8 |a Annotation  |b This volume is the outcome of deliberations on formal methods in aerospace. The book specially delves into the use of formal methods for verification, validation, and optimization of software in safety critical and time critical applications, such as those in aerospace engineering. The chapters in this book are authored by leading corporate and government R & D scientists. The contents of this book will be useful to researchers and professionals alike. 
590 |a ProQuest Ebook Central  |b Ebook Central Academic Complete 
650 0 |a Formal methods (Computer science) 
650 4 |a Software engineering. 
650 6 |a Méthodes formelles (Informatique) 
650 7 |a Formal methods (Computer science)  |2 fast 
700 1 |a Jeppu, Yogananda. 
758 |i has work:  |a Formal Methods for Safety and Security (Text)  |1 https://id.oclc.org/worldcat/entity/E39PCYPFTwJYmqHbygPkKYx6jC  |4 https://id.oclc.org/worldcat/ontology/hasWork 
776 0 8 |i Print version:  |a Nanda, Manju.  |t Formal Methods for Safety and Security : Case Studies for Aerospace Applications.  |d Singapore : Springer Singapore, ©2017  |z 9789811041204 
856 4 0 |u https://ebookcentral.uam.elogim.com/lib/uam-ebooks/detail.action?docID=5143834  |z Texto completo 
938 |a Askews and Holts Library Services  |b ASKH  |n AH33859876 
938 |a ProQuest Ebook Central  |b EBLB  |n EBL5143834 
994 |a 92  |b IZTAP